Inheritance & Traits
DNA โ genes โ proteins โ traits. Plus how variation is created and passed on.
๐ The flow: DNA โ Trait
DNAโGeneโmRNAโProteinโTrait
Hierarchy: DNA is the molecule. Genes are sections of DNA. Chromosomes are tightly packed DNA. Same stuff, different scale.

๐งช Mutations
Silent
Change in DNA but protein still works. No effect.
Harmful
Breaks the protein. Disease (e.g., sickle cell).
Beneficial
Gives an advantage (e.g., lactose tolerance). Raw material for evolution.

๐ง Quick reveals
What's the difference between mitosis and meiosis?โพ
Mitosis = body cells, 1 โ 2 identical cells. Meiosis = sex cells (gametes), 1 โ 4 unique cells with HALF the chromosomes.
Why does sexual reproduction matter for evolution?โพ
It shuffles genes โ more variation โ more raw material for natural selection.
Are mutations always bad?โพ
No. Most are silent or neutral. Some are harmful, some are beneficial. They're the source of new variation.
